Global Electrodialysis Systems and Equipment Market (USD Million), 2021 - 2031

In the year 2024, the Global Electrodialysis Systems and Equipment Market was valued at USD 310.63 million. The size of this market is expected to increase to USD 406.02 million by the year 2031, while growing at a Compounded Annual Growth Rate (CAGR) of 3.9%.

Electrodialysis (ED) is an electrochemical process that utilizes ion-exchange membranes to separate ions from solutions, making it a crucial technology for desalination, purification, and concentration applications. This market encompasses a wide range of systems and equipment designed for various industrial and municipal applications, including water purification, brine treatment, and food and beverage processing. The technology is valued for its efficiency and environmental benefits, particularly its ability to reduce energy consumption compared to traditional methods like reverse osmosis. As global water scarcity issues intensify and industries seek more sustainable practices, the demand for advanced electrodialysis systems is projected to grow, driving innovation and expansion in this sector.
